Draa is a fictional soldier and a minor character featured in the Star Wars multimedia franchise. He appeared on the Star Wars: The Clone Wars computer animated series where he was voiced by actor Dee Bradley Baker. He was introduced in the sixth episode of season two, "Weapons Factory".
Biography[]
Draa was the nickname or call-sign of a clone trooper cultivated from the genetic template of bounty hunter Jango Fett. Like all clones, he was biologically modified with programming directives and artificially aged into adulthood.
Draa served in the Grand Army of the Republic during the Clone Wars. In 22 BBY, Draa and his squad participated in the Second Battle of Geonosis under the command of Captain Rex. Draa used his weaponry as he engaged B1 battle droids and Droidekas on a bridge leading to a weapons factory on Geonosis.
